Viltrox Unveils New Conversion Lenses for Fujifilm X100 Series

Viltrox has officially introduced two new conversion lenses designed for the Fujifilm X100 series, giving photographers wider and tighter fields of view without sacrificing the camera’s compact, fixed‑lens charm. The announcement brings fresh flexibility to one of the most viral and in‑demand cameras on the market, offering both wide‑angle and telephoto perspectives for creators who want more than the built‑in 35mm‑equivalent view.

According to Viltrox, the new lenses—WCL‑X100VI (Wide Conversion Lens) and TCL‑X100VI (Tele Conversion Lens)—are engineered specifically for the X100 lineup and maintain the camera’s native optical performance, sharpness, and illumination consistency. The pair aims to expand the X100’s creative range by adding two additional focal lengths: 28mm equivalent and 50mm equivalent.

Two New Focal Lengths: 28mm and 50mm

The Fujifilm X100 series features a built‑in 23mm f/2 lens (35mm equivalent). While beloved for its versatility, the single focal length can be limiting for travel, street, and documentary shooters. Viltrox’s new conversion lenses directly address that:

WCL‑X100VI (Wide Conversion Lens)

  • 0.8× magnification
  • Converts the X100 to a 19mm lens, equivalent to 28mm on full‑frame
  • Ideal for landscapes, architecture, and environmental portraits

TCL‑X100VI (Tele Conversion Lens)

  • 1.4× magnification
  • Converts the X100 to a 33mm lens, equivalent to 50mm on full‑frame
  • Great for portraits, detail shots, and tighter framing

Both lenses feature auto‑recognition, allowing the X100 body to automatically adjust focal mapping and optical corrections for accurate rendering.

A New Alternative to Fujifilm’s Own Converters

Fujifilm has long offered its own WCL and TCL options, but they haven’t been updated since the X100F era. With the X100VI’s surge in popularity, Viltrox’s modernized versions arrive at the perfect time—especially for photographers seeking more affordable or readily available alternatives.

DPReview notes that the X100’s fixed‑lens design has always been part of its charm, but also its limitation. These new Viltrox adapters directly address that by giving users “two additional fields of view” without needing a second camera or interchangeable‑lens system.
